About Your Adventure
YOU are a reporter for a top-ranked mystery podcast, and you’re out to crack the biggest case yet: Do swamp monsters exist? To find out, you’ll investigate some of history’s greatest swamp monsters. Will you catch a real-life monster or become part of the legend?
Chapter One sets the scene. Then you choose which path to read. Follow the links at the bottom of each page as you read the stories. The decisions you make will change your outcome. After you finish one path, go back and read the others for new perspectives and more adventures. Use your device's back buttons or page navigation to jump back to your last choice.
CHAPTER 1
Monstercast
For years, you’ve been a reporter for a podcast about strange happenings called Don’t Turn Out the Light.
You’ve reported stories about unsolved mysteries, stolen treasure, UFOs, and a guy who claimed he could read people’s minds. Your work has taken you all over the world. You’ve been in haunted mansions, abandoned mines, secret gangster hideouts, and exotic cities.
Depictions of swamp monsters vary widely from place to place. In New Orleans, Louisiana, a hairy, werewolf-like creature known as Rougarou supposedly haunts local swamps.
One thing you love about your job is finding out what’s really going on behind these mysteries. Most of the time, there’s an easy explanation. The ghost of Donner Pass
turned out to be a local rancher. The rancher used a hologram to scare away developers who wanted to put a shopping center near his land.
Sometimes, though, there’s no good explanation for the story—and that’s what you really love about the job. True mystery! You never figured out how that guy was so good at reading minds. Maybe he really did have a superpower. And UFOs? You must admit, some of those stories are very convincing.
You’ve always been interested in swamp monster stories, and the way they can turn a community upside down. At the weekly meeting with your producer, Lizzie, you tell her that you’d like to do a story on one of these.
Hot tamale!
Lizzie says, slapping her palms onto the table. That’s a great idea. If we find a good one, we could probably get a full season out of it.
Lizzie always dresses in a collared T-shirt and jeans. It gives her a professional look that masks her daring and courage.
You know she’ll want to go with you to report the story—and she’ll probably lead the charge into the swamp.
You’re already thinking about the exciting trip into some muddy, gator-filled swamp as you do research. You narrow it down to three types of monsters that you might investigate. The Honey Island Swamp Monster is an apelike creature that lives in Louisiana. People call it the "Cajun Sasquatch." The Lizard Man of Lee County has been spotted by several witnesses in South Carolina. Then there’s the Bunyip—a mysterious creature that lives in the billabongs of Australia.
To hunt the Honey Island Swamp Monster, press here.
To search for the Lizard Man of Lee County, press here.
To follow the Bunyip of Australia, press here.
